After missing out on Kirk Cousins, the New York Jets addressed their gaping hole at quarterback Tuesday by bringing back Josh McCown, his agent announced via Twitter.
Congrats to @JoshMcCown12 agreeing to a 1 year deal with the @nyjets
McCown, 38, is expected to sign a one-year, $10 million contract when free agency opens on Wednesday, a source said.
The Jets had always expressed an interest in re-signing McCown as their fallback option -- and they may not be finished. They're also in talks with free agent Teddy Bridgewater, a source said.
